However, to learn, you need to develop a general troubleshooting approach - a logical, methodical, method of narrowing down the problem. A tech tip database might suggest: 'Replace C536' for a particular symptom. This is good advice for a specific problem on one model. However, what you really want to understand is why C536 was the cause and how to pinpoint the culprit in general even if you don't have a service manual or schematic and your tech tip database doesn't have an entry for your sick TV or VCR.

While schematics are nice, you won't always have them or be able to justify the purchase for a one-of repair. Therefore, in many cases, some reverse engineering will be necessary. The time will be well spent since even if you don't see another instance of the same model in your entire lifetime, you will have learned something in the process that can be applied to other equipment problems.
As always, when you get stuck, checking out a tech-tips database may quickly identify your problem and solution.In that case, you can greatly simplify your troubleshooting or at least confirm a diagnosis before ordering parts.

REPAIRING / SERVICING TV PHILIPS 55PFL6606K

Technical description and composition of the PHILIPS 55PFL6606K TV, panel type and modules used. The composition of the modules.
PHILIPS LED
Model: 55PFL6606K / 02
Chassis / Version: Q552.2E LA
Panel: LC550EUF-SDA1
LED driver (backlight): integrated into PSU
PWM LED driver: OZ9902GN SOP24
MOSFET LED driver: AOD450
Power Supply (PSU): PLDK-P011A PSL55-2
PWM Power: FA5591 (PFC), L6599, LNK362 (Stb)
MOSFET Power: 11N60 (PFC), STK0160
MainBoard: 313929714851 // 313929711861
IC MainBoard: PNX85537 29F4C08ABADA TPA3120D2
Tuner: TH2603

General recommendations for TV LCD LED repair
Possible manifestations of defects
- PHILIPS 55PFL6606K TV does not turn on, does not respond to the remote control and control panel buttons, does not light up or blink indicators.
In such cases, the PLDK-P011A power supply usually fails. Then we recommend that you measure its output voltages and, if they are absent, you should check the serviceability of the power switches (11N60 (PFC), STK0160) and the rectifier diodes of the converters for a possible short circuit.
In case of any breakdowns in the secondary circuits, the converter can operate in an emergency mode of a short circuit, and with a short circuit in the power elements of the primary circuit, the mains fuse or the current sensor at the source of the key is often cut off.
Mos-Fet power switches used in switching power supplies sometimes fail due to a malfunction of any other elements that can disable it in the key mode, or create an excess of the maximum permissible key parameters. These can be elements supplying a PWM regulator, frequency setting or damper circuits, or elements of negative feedback in the stabilization circuit. PWM controllers FA5591 (PFC), L6599, LNK362 (Stb), in the absence of visible damage or outright short circuits between the terminals, are checked by replacing them with new ones, or known to be working properly.
- There is no image, there is sound, it reacts to the remote control. Or, immediately after switching on for a second, the image may appear and immediately disappear.
In some of these cases, the malfunction is caused by the lack of display backlighting. The reason can be found in the malfunction of the LEDs, in the violation of the contact connections of the LED strips, or in the provision of their power supply (LED driver).
Without a special current source, it is impossible to check the line of series-connected LEDs, and it is unsafe for them to use any voltage sources over 12V for this purpose. Then all that remains is to open the panel and check each LED separately. Usually, Chinese multimeters with 9V power supply lightly light up one 3-volt LED, if you connect the probes to it in the forward direction, the red probe to the anode, the black one to the cathode. For dual 6-volt LEDs, the PN junction of its emergency zener diode can serve as an indicator of the LED health. In the event of a malfunction of the LED, its zener diode will either be cut off or pierced in the K / Z.

If the PHILIPS 55PFL6606K has no picture, but there is sound, the LC550EUF-SDA1 display backlight often simply does not work. Moreover, in LED TVs, the LEDs inside the panel usually fail, less often the LED driver.
In such cases, you can see a barely noticeable image with a successful hit of external light on the screen.
Replacing the LEDs requires disassembling the LC550EUF-SDA1 LCD panel - a process that requires experience and qualifications from the technician. I do not recommend doing such work on your own to the owners of TVs and craftsmen who do not have experience in repairing LCD panels


If there is no image, and the backlight is on, the screen becomes slightly lighter when turned on, and in an open TV you can see the light through the holes in the panel case.
In this case, the panel may also be faulty - damage to strips, loops, for example, as a result of moisture ingress after unsuccessful washing of the screen, the T-CON (Timing Controller) board may be faulty. But often the main board MainBoard 313929714851 turns out to be faulty, a software failure is also possible.
Then, first of all, you need to check the panel supply voltage, the fuses on the T-CON board, as well as the supply and reference voltages of the column and line drivers - VGH, VGL, Vcom.


If these measurements are within normal limits, it is necessary to trace the passage of LVDS signals from MainBoard 313929714851, as well as synchronizing signals to loops with drivers, with an oscilloscope.
Flooded or unsuccessfully washed screens of LED TVs can be restored, in about half of the cases, usually if significant damage has not formed in the loops and panel strips.


- The TV does not turn on, the indicator signals the standby or operating mode, or blinks.
Repair or diagnostics of the motherboard 313929714851 should begin with checking the stabilizers and power converters necessary to power the microcircuits and matrix. If necessary, you should update or replace the software (software). In cases of complex MB (SSB) repairs and with the necessary skills and equipment, it may sometimes be necessary to replace its PNX85537 29F4C08ABADA TPA3120D2 chips and other possible faulty components. Malfunctions associated with the use of BGA soldering technologies are usually easily diagnosed by the warm-up method.
Before changing the TH2603 tuner, if it is not possible to tune to television channels, you should make sure that there are supply voltages, which must be measured at the corresponding terminals of the tuner and check the software for correctness. The pulses of the data exchange of the tuner with the processor can be monitored with an oscilloscope.

 Revision after repair of the backlight. Information from the master.
Decrease the backlight current from 380 mA mA to 270 mA. Removed two 12 Ohm resistors in each channel R455, R455A and R468, R468A.

The main features of the PHILIPS 55PFL6606K device:
Installed matrix (LED panel) LC550EUF-SDA1.
To power the backlight LEDs, a converter combined with a power supply is used, controlled by an OZ9902GN SOP24 PWM controller. The keys of the AOD450 type are used as power elements of the LED driver.
The formation of the necessary supply voltages for all nodes of the PHILIPS 55PFL6606K TV is carried out by the PLDK-P011A power module, or its analogs using FA5591 (PFC), L6599, LNK362 (Stb) microcircuits and 11N60 (PFC), STK0160 power switches.
MainBoard - the main board (motherboard) is a module 313929714851, using PNX85537 29F4C08ABADA TPA3120D2 chips and others.
The TH2603 tuner provides reception of television programs and tuning to channels.
Additional technical information about the panel:
Brand: LG Display
Model: LC550EUF-SDA1
Type: a-Si TFT-LCD, Panel
Diagonal size: 55 inch
Resolution: 1920x1080, FHD
Display Mode: S-IPS, Normally Black, Transmissive


Active Area: 1209.6x680.4 mm
Surface: Antiglare (Haze 10%), Hard coating (3H)
Brightness: 450 cd / m²
Contrast Ratio: 1600: 1
Display Colors: 16.7M / 1.06B (8-bit / 8-bit + FRC), CIE1931 72%
Response Time: 5 (G to G); 8 (MPRT)
Frequency: 120Hz
Lamp Type: WLED Without Driver
Signal Interface: LVDS (4 ch, 8/10-bit), 92 pins
Voltage: 12.0V

 

 PHILIPS 55PFL6606K LCD TV 55 "(140 cm) 16: 9. The required brightness of 400 cd / m2 is provided by LED backlighting. This model uses edge LED backlighting. The design and technical capabilities of the TV provide viewing of broadcasts and movies in high quality HD at a resolution of 1920x1080 pixels in graphic resolution at 1080p (Full HD). The 55PFL6606K TV is equipped with SMART software and the ability to work on the Internet. The connection to the network can be carried out via Wi-Fi wireless connection. The input high-frequency or video signal can be processed in analog systems PAL, SECAM, NTSC. Graphic processing and formation of a digital signal occurs in the standards 480i, 480p, 576i, 576p, 720p, 1080i, 1080p. Supported media file formats: MP3, WMA, MPEG4, MKV, JPEG. Speaker power 28 W (2x14 W) is provided by two speakers. Uses NICAM stereo processing system and Sound Surround function. External interface (communication with other devices) is supported by standard input and output connectors: antenna input (RF), audio x2, component, SCART, RGB, VGA, HDMI x3, USB, Ethernet (RJ-45). A headphone output is provided. To connect a computer or laptop to this TV model, a VGA (D-Sub 15) connector on the TV case is used, this interface supports resolutions: 640x480, 800x600, 1024x768, 1280x1024, 1360x768, 1920x1080. The digital tuner is capable of receiving TV channels in the DVB-T, DVB-C, DVB-S2 standards. The power consumed when operating from the mains is 66 W. Dimensions: with stand 1286x820x295 mm, without stand 1286x756x40 mm. TV weight: with stand: 30 kg, without stand: 26 kg. Attention! The panel of the PHILIPS 55PFL6606K LED TV is an expensive and unreliable element. 

Avoid any impacts on the glass and pressure on the screen surface to avoid damage to the LED panel! It is also unsafe for liquid to spill onto the screen. Sometimes one drop is enough if it drips down the glass onto the cables to make the TV unrepairable
